Historical Perspectives on Chance

Throughout history, cultures have interpreted chance differently. Ancient Greeks attributed events to divine will, while Renaissance thinkers like Pascal explored probability mathematically. Modern science now frames randomness as a core aspect of quantum mechanics, challenging deterministic views of the universe.

Scientific Approaches to Chance

Science defines chance through statistical models and probability theory. Researchers analyze randomness in genetics, weather patterns, and economic trends. These frameworks help quantify unpredictability, transforming luck into measurable variables for informed decision-making.

  • Probability calculations predict outcomes in games of chance, such as roulette or lotteries.
  • Randomness in natural phenomena, like radioactive decay, challenges deterministic laws.
  • Chaos theory explores how small chance events can trigger massive systemic changes.

How Chance Influences Success

Many breakthroughs stem from chance encounters or unexpected opportunities. Innovators like Alexander Fleming discovered penicillin through serendipity, highlighting how luck and probability intertwine with effort. Studies show that embracing randomness enhances resilience and creativity.

Psychological Views on Chance

Psychologists study how humans perceive luck and chance. Some attribute success to skill, while others credit fate. Cognitive biases, like the “illusion of control,” distort perceptions of probability, affecting risk-taking behaviors and decision-making processes.

Cultural Attitudes Toward Chance

Cultures globally approach chance uniquely. Western societies often emphasize individual agency, while Eastern philosophies like Taoism embrace randomness as part of cosmic balance. These perspectives influence how people respond to opportunity and luck in their lives.
